What are firemen called in England?

The Old Fire Service Rank Markings.

Role Abbreviation Responsibilities
Firefighter Ff General station Duties
Leading firefighter Lff Officer in charge of an appliance
Sub officer SubO Officer in charge of a watch or deputy officer in charge of a watch
Station Officer StnO Officer in charge of a watch or station commander

How much does a retained fireman earn UK?

Do on-call firefighters get paid? On average, an on-call (or retained) firefighter can earn from £6,000 to £8,000 a year. We offer a range of contracts between 40 and 120 hours cover a week for which you will be paid a retaining fee.

Do fire stations still have poles UK?

They were introduced into London fire stations from 1904 onwards. Initially the poles just went through an open hole in the upper floor. However, these holes were soon given greater protection to avoid accidents. Sliding poles are still in active use in many London fire stations.

How many fire stations closed in UK?

10 fire stations
The following 10 fire stations will close: Belsize, Bow, Clerkenwell, Downham, Kingsland, Knightsbridge, Silvertown, Southwark, Westminster and Woolwich. Second fire engines will be removed from seven fire stations at: Chingford, Clapham, Hayes, Leyton, Leytonstone, Peckham and Whitechapel.
